This home is nestled in clean HOA neighborhood at the opening of a culdesac, close to groceries, I-40, Buffalo Park, churches, hospital and easy access to Fort Valley Road on the way to Snow Bowl. The historic downtown Flagstaff is minutes away offering shopping, restaurants and night life. Home has two queen beds (new mattresses) and one full bed in upstair carpeted bedrooms. Round wooden dining table seats four. The back deck and spacious yard face the evening sunset and are open to forest land. This simple home is all newly remodeled. It has an ample driveway for off street parking. Antenna TV and high speed Internet (suddenlink). No pets.
